Brexit uncertainty is crippling businesses - Essex farmer
Farmers have called for clarity over what post-Brexit support they will receive to improve the environment.
Essex farmer Tom Bradshaw, who is also deputy president of the National Farmers' Union, said the "uncertainty is crippling businesses".
After the UK left the EU, instead of European subsidies a replacement scheme was proposed for farmers, but this has been put back.
The government said it was right to review the scheme.
